Last minute cancelled non-refundable booking 6 months ago and still no refund. I can't contact them!

Hi,
I have been trying since April to contact Lastminute.com, we successfully spoke to someone early on, who confirmed that an email would come to us within a week with refund options. Well, that email never came!
Back in March lastminute.com cancelled our London hotel booking. The hotel was a non-refundable hotel and was booked late February before we realised just how bad COVID was going to be.  Anyway, we called the hotel as we wanted to just move the booking to a later date as we were due to go in April, they informed us that lastminute had already contacted them to cancel the booking - we thought, oh well, we'll get the money back and just book again.
We also had a trip to Paris booked for May, this was cancelled and repaid back within 3 weeks...! so, I am so confused as to why we haven't received the other refund.
I went onto my lastminute.com profile and the booking has now moved into 'past bookings' and has been greyed out....?? If you try to search for it, it says it the booking reference doesn't exist?
I tried to call the free number but that no longer works. So, I thought that I'd try to call the one that costs 13p per minute (which is now free again), this one now says that the phones lines are not operating at the moment and diverts you back to the web - where you literally can't do anything!!! Where has the online support go... surely they can't still be that busy for people to man this?

Can anyone help - I just need a number or an email. I've tried resolver and Twitter, I am  now currently trying to claim it back through my card which is a long process.
